    More info on the CM spin-off.. Source: EW

    Scoop: Forest Whitaker to headline 'Criminal Minds' spin-off!

    Oscar winner Forest Whitaker is nearing a deal to headline CBS’ in-the-works spin-off of Criminal Minds, sources confirm to me semi-exclusively.

    Whitaker would play Cooper, the new team’s fiercely loyal and intensely private leader. A former star profiler in the BAU, Coop’s been off the grid for the last eight years — leaving only a trail of rumors in his wake.

    Minds 2.0 will follow the NCIS/NCIS: LA model in that the new team will be introduced in an episode of Minds this spring before being launched into their own show next fall. Seasoned industry professionals like myself refer to it as a “planted” spin-off.

    This is Whitaker’s first regular TV gig since his mesmerizing turn as Michael Chiklis’ arch-nemesis, Jon Kavanaugh, on The Shield.

    Air Date: Wednesday, February 10, 2010
    Time Slot: 9:00 PM-10:00 PM EST on CBS
    Episode Title: (#515) "Public Enemy"

    THE BAU TEAM PROFILES A SERIAL KILLER WHO MURDERS HIS VICTIMS IN PUBLIC PLACES TO INSTILL FEAR IN A CITY'S INHABITANTS. - serial killer who targets random victims in highly visible places to create a sense of public fear is the subject of a BAU investigation. - The BAU is summoned to Rhode Island to investigate a serial killer in Providence who is murdering random victims in highly visible places just to generate public fear.
